Strong's Hebrew #1266 - בֻּרוֹת beroth (cypress or fir)


Original Word: בֻּרוֹת
Transliteration: beroth
Definition: cypress or fir
Part of Speech: Noun Masculine
Phonetic Spelling: (ber-oth')

Strong's Exhaustive Concordance

fir

A variation of browsh; the cypress (or some elastic tree) -- fir.

see HEBREW browsh


Englishman's Concordance

1) cypress, fir, juniper, pine
Part of Speech: noun masculine plural
A Related Word by BDB/Strong’s Number: a variation of H1265
Same Word by TWOT Number: 289a

Brown-Driver-Briggs

[בְּרוֺת] noun masculine id. (Aramaic (probably North-Palestinian) form of same) only plural בְּרוֺתִים "" אֲרָזִים Songs 1:17; reference to arbour of trees as their home, compare אֶרֶז.

Englishman's Concordance (References)

Strong's Hebrew: 1266. בְּרוֹתִים (beroth) — 1 Occurrence

Songs 1:17
HEB: (רַהִיטֵ֖נוּ ק) בְּרוֹתִֽים׃
NAS: are cedars, Our rafters, cypresses.
KJV: [are] cedar, [and] our rafters of fir.
INT: are cedars rafter cypresses
